How they compare
Gibraltar currently reports 100.0% against 99.7% in Singapore, a difference of 0.3%.
The two have swapped places 1 time across 15 shared years of data; in 1950 it was Singapore ahead.
Gibraltar ranks 1st and Singapore ranks 4th of 236 countries.
Across the 8 decades both report, Gibraltar averaged higher in 6 and Singapore in 2.

About this data
Estimated share of the population living in cities. Cities are identified using satellite imagery and population data, applying the same definitions across countries.
